What can you cook with Philips pressure cooker?

You can use your Philips Premium All-in-One to sauté, cook stews, soups, rice and risotto. You can even steam dishes, make yoghurt, and bake memorable cakes and desserts for any occasion.

What can’t you cook in a pressure cooker?

Ingredients to Avoid Using in the Instant Pot

  • Breaded meats. Even when placed on a rack, breaded meats or vegetables are not recommended due to the fact that the breading will get soggy as the pressure cooker cooks with steam. …
  • Delicate Cuts of Meat. …
  • Quick Cooking Dishes. …
  • Bread. …
  • Cookies. …
  • Thickeners.

Can you wash pressure cooker lid?

With the anti-block shield and sealing ring removed, wash the Instant Pot lid in warm, soapy water or place it on the top rack of the dishwasher. … Once clean, check the lid’s steam release valve and float valve to ensure they’re clear of food particles that could prevent the cooker from maintaining pressure.

Can you put oil in a pressure cooker?

What is this? Pressure cooking in oil is not possible to do in an ordinary domestic pressure cooker. If you wish to deep fry your food, you need to invest in a deep fat fryer or chip pan. Of course, if you want to fry off your ingredients before they cook under pressure, this is perfectly safe and acceptable.

Is it better to slow cook or pressure cook?

Slow cookers are much better for cooking root vegetables and tough cuts of meat because the long, low-temperature cooking process is great for adding moisture and breaking down fat. It is not recommended that you cook leaner meats in a slow cooker, but they can be prepared no problem in a pressure cooker.
